#5159d6 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5159d6 is composed of 31.8% red, 34.9% green and 83.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 62.1% cyan, 58.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 16.1% black. It has a hue angle of 236.4 degrees, a saturation of 61.9% and a lightness of 57.8%. #5159d6 color hex could be obtained by blending #a2b2ff with #0000ad. Closest websafe color is: #6666cc.

Shades and Tints of #5159d6

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000001 is the darkest color, while #f0f0fb is the lightest one.
